What is meant by "minimum design standards" in highway construction?

Explanation:
"Minimum design standards" in highway construction refer to established guidelines that dictate the required specifications for safety, functionality, and durability of highways. These standards ensure that the roadway can accommodate the expected traffic loads, provide safe passage for vehicles, and endure various environmental conditions over time. In highway design, safety is paramount; hence, these standards cover critical factors such as lane widths, shoulder widths, sight distances, vertical and horizontal alignments, and material specifications. By adhering to these guidelines, engineers can ensure that the roadway is constructed to prevent accidents, maintain structural integrity under various loads, and provide a serviceable lifespan that meets the demands of highway users.
